Output 3e40af6dca396b03c427e0ae1732786b95f2bad60f10eddc5ea0f19d8b1012c4:3

value
15213040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62e09eda7f24532b261224854749904deb35b27d OP_EQUAL
address
3AhqEFVC1NvrQunpNMxduf9NvBa3NhfHru
transaction
3e40af6dca396b03c427e0ae1732786b95f2bad60f10eddc5ea0f19d8b1012c4
spent
true